Born to Elihu Martin Ashley (1825-1900) & his second wife, Delila Jane Jones Ashley (1827-1903).

David married Selina Josephine Beall (1870-1956) on Dec. 17, 1890, in Copiah County, MS. He was a mailman and furniture manufacturer in Ashley, MS.

Eleven children:
• Martha Clara Ashley Wallace (1892-1988)
• Ida Beall Ashley Windham (1893-1983)
• Mittie Verde Ashley Stitt (1895-1988)
• Walter Martin Ashley (1896-1985)
• Augustus Beall Ashley (1898-1898)
• David Cicero Ashley (1899-1936)
• Ernest Hemby Ashley (1901-1981)
• Thelma Josephine Ashley Litton (1903-1992)
• Thomas Everett Ashley (1905-1980)
• Quintory Victoria Ashley Thomas (1907-1999)
• Ruby Catherine Ashley (1910-1995)

The "Ashley" chair, designed and made by David Gilpin Ashley, can be found in the Smithsonian Museum in Washington, DC.
